So here the cover Was not torqued properly which in my opinion aloud all sorts of elements in including condensation which at 3am is going to happen especially on those cold nights made a perfect conductor to an improperly grounded circuit. i repulsed new conductors to the trashed ones, properly grounded the circuit and put a cover suited for its elements been all year and no sparks I’ll check later this year when I have more time if the cover held up
Here’s another one same facility different fixture (needless to say the old electrician Is no longer there) Here’s a thought Someone else might se your work way up there!
Diagnosis;Burnt out ballast to an old fixture
Remedy; Retro fit corn light
